03 / Spending Trend
PSC F107 contract spending by fiscal year
Annual obligations, activity, and participation across the same FY 2019–FY 2025 profile window.
| Fiscal year | Obligations | Actions | Vendors | Customers | Change |
|---|---|---|---|---|---|
| FY 2019 | $13.47M | 340 | 90 | 25 | — |
| FY 2020 | $12.07M | 343 | 89 | 27 | −10.4% |
| FY 2021 | $17.01M | 249 | 104 | 30 | +40.9% |
| FY 2022 | $14.71M | 312 | 86 | 27 | −13.5% |
| FY 2023 | $16.47M | 222 | 99 | 27 | +12.0% |
| FY 2024 | $17.07M | 214 | 110 | 30 | +3.6% |
| FY 2025 | $17.61M | 202 | 98 | 27 | +3.2% |

10 / Market Interpretation
How should contractors evaluate this market?
Start with the spending direction
Compare annual obligations with actions and vendor participation. Growth driven by only a few large actions represents a different opportunity from broad, recurring demand.
Follow the actual buyers
Move from federal customers to contracting offices. Offices reveal where acquisition responsibility and recurring purchasing activity are concentrated.
Measure accessible demand
Use competition, small-business participation, incumbent vendors, and PSC mix before treating the full $108.41M market as addressable.
